Correlation Between Pupal Weight and Fecundity of Catolaccus grandis (Burks)

S. M. Greenberg, J. A. Morales-Ramos, and E. G. King


 
ABSTRACT

A significant correlation (R2 = 0.944, F = 1090.8) was found between weight of female pupae of Catolaccus grandis (Burks) and total fecundity during the first 30 days of oviposition. The use of this correlation to assess quality of mass reared females of C. grandis is discussed.
